Condición de prueba frente a escenario de prueba: ¿Cuál es la diferencia?

Tabla de contenido:

Anonim

¿Qué es un escenario de prueba?

Un escenario de prueba es una forma o método probable de probar una aplicación. Se define como una funcionalidad de la vida real que se puede probar para una aplicación bajo prueba. Un escenario de prueba coloca al evaluador en la posición del usuario final para descubrir escenarios del mundo real y casos de uso de la Aplicación bajo prueba. También se le llama Prueba de Posibilidad.

Condición de prueba

La condición de prueba en las pruebas de software es la especificación que debe seguir un probador para probar una aplicación de software. La condición de prueba es un conjunto específico de restricciones que puede contener funcionalidades como transacciones, funciones o elementos estructurales para casos de prueba con el fin de probar la aplicación de software. Las condiciones de prueba ayudan a garantizar que una aplicación de software esté libre de errores.

Las condiciones de prueba se derivan de casos de uso y escenarios de prueba de la vida real. Puede haber varias condiciones de prueba en un escenario de prueba.

La diferencia entre el escenario de prueba y la condición de prueba es una pregunta frecuente muy común entre los principiantes de control de calidad.

DIFERENCIA CLAVE

  • El escenario de prueba es una forma de probar una aplicación, mientras que la condición de prueba es una restricción que se debe seguir para probar una aplicación.
  • El escenario de prueba puede ser uno o un grupo de casos de prueba, mientras que la condición de prueba es una parte de la funcionalidad.
  • El escenario de prueba ayuda a reducir la complejidad, mientras que la condición de prueba ayuda a garantizar que una aplicación esté libre de errores.
  • El escenario de prueba cubre una amplia gama de posibilidades, mientras que la condición de prueba es muy específica.

A continuación se muestra una comparación detallada

Diferencia entre la condición de prueba y el caso de prueba

Escenario de prueba Condición de prueba
  • El escenario de prueba es una forma posible de probar una aplicación.
  • La condición de prueba es la restricción que debe seguir para probar una aplicación.
  • El escenario de prueba puede ser uno o un grupo de casos de prueba
  • La condición de prueba puede ser una parte de la funcionalidad o cualquier cosa que desee verificar. En términos simples, el objetivo de los casos de prueba
  • Es importante cuando el tiempo es menor y la mayoría de los miembros del equipo comprenden los detalles de un escenario de una línea.
  • Es un elemento o evento de un sistema que podría verificarse mediante uno o más casos de prueba. P.ej; transacción, función, elemento estructural, etc.
  • Se puede lograr una buena cobertura de prueba dividiendo la aplicación en escenarios de prueba, lo que reduce la complejidad
  • Una buena condición de prueba garantiza que el sistema esté libre de errores
  • El escenario de prueba es bastante vago y cubre una amplia gama de posibilidades
  • Las condiciones de prueba son muy específicas
Ejemplo de escenario de prueba: para realizar pruebas, tiene muchas formas, como pruebas positivas, pruebas negativas, BVA, etc. Ejemplo de condición de prueba: cuando el nombre de usuario y la contraseña son válidos, una aplicación avanzará